Aid for flood victims in Thailand
In response to this situation, the Artelia Foundation has drawn on its emergency fund to support Enfants du Mékong’s relief efforts for the affected communities. Thanks to its local presence and knowledge of the area, the organisation was able to quickly identify the priority needs of the hardest-hit families.
Initially, teams carried out visits to local residents to assess the extent of the damage and provide immediate assistance. Food and hygiene kits were distributed to 180 families to meet their basic needs in the days following the disaster.
The response then continued with support for the rehabilitation of homes and the return to normal daily life. The project helped families to replace damaged belongings, purchase furniture, repair their homes and buy essential supplies, including school uniforms for the children.
